The Cisco ASR-903= is a compact aggregation services router designed for carrier-grade Ethernet and IP/MPLS deployments. Built for service providers and enterprises requiring high availability, it supports sub-50ms failover, modular uplinks, and advanced QoS features. Unlike traditional routers, the ASR-903= emphasizes scalability in constrained spaces, making it ideal for edge deployments where physical footprint and power efficiency matter.

Q: Is the ASR-903= suitable for 5G transport networks?
A: Yes. Its support for Precision Time Protocol (PTP) and low-latency forwarding makes it viable for 5G fronthaul/backhaul.
Q: How does licensing work for advanced features?
A: Cisco’s tiered licensing model applies. Base routing is included, but features like MPLS or advanced security require additional subscriptions.
